You are not alone in having driving issues, Tiddler. I am a horrible driver. I have only had three or four minor collisions, all at low speeds, so far though. I did extensive damage to my car though when I hit a parking column because I was arguing with someone in the passenger seat at the time. Loads of near misses, too many to enumerate easily. I hate going to the mall because of the parking the most.

Some new cars have cameras in the side mirrors that notify you via a light if a car is in your blind spot. I want that for my next vehicle. And a backup camera. And an automatic brake to ensure I don’t collide with anything. When are personal transportation pods coming?

As for parking, I can’t tolerate going around and looking. Grab the first spot I see and walk it. Otherwise, my stress levels go through the roof.

There was a study that found people with ADHD fared better at driving if they were driving a standard transmission as they would were more engaged in the process. Not sure what the sample size of it was though.

Dr. Russell Barkley’s brother, who had ADHD, was killed in a traffic accident.
